Jump to content


Photo

CT ET9x00 and newest PLI -> spool records problems !


  • Please log in to reply
56 replies to this topic

Re: CT ET9x00 and newest PLI -> spool records problems ! #41 PainHealer

  • Member
  • 17 posts

0
Neutral

Posted 30 November 2011 - 19:00

Ok,

makes sense. But why does it wind reverse (even if not really clean) but stops when trying to wind forward? Is there anything that can be done against this issue? Not that I need default speeds higher 8x at all, but in reverse winding it always looks far away from clean and I feel like winding speeds over all are far away from "realtime".

I guess this behavior is mostly true for spooling in timeshift mode? The CT9100 is my first "e2" based STB, but at this moment I really don't like the way spooling is implemented at all. Is there any chance this will be fixed/improved in the future? Compared to most other "closed source" STBs it does looks "ugly" and is not somthing to be happy about in daily use. Does it depend on the used hardware or is just just a software topic?

Thanks for your help and the hard work on OpenPLi!

Regards

PainHealer

Re: CT ET9x00 and newest PLI -> spool records problems ! #42 PainHealer

  • Member
  • 17 posts

0
Neutral

Posted 30 November 2011 - 19:49

Ok,

one more addition to this topic: At Clarke Tech Forums I was asked not to "mix up" two different problems in this thread.

Just to clarify this: Besides the issue with the "default wind speed higher than 8x" there is still the other issue where certain recordings can not be spooled at 16x (or higher), even if the default winding speed is 2x-8x. As already mentioned by Biki3 at the beginning of this thread, it looks like the .ap-files have to do something with this issue. On certain channels/tansponders (RTL, VOX, etc.) the .ap seems to be corrupted during the recording, which causes the playback to "hang" when spooled at speeds above 8x.

Regards

PainHealer

Re: CT ET9x00 and newest PLI -> spool records problems ! #43 MiLo

  • PLi® Core member
  • 14,055 posts

+298
Excellent

Posted 30 November 2011 - 20:08

Do you have an example of a channel that has this problem? (And by channel, i mean something that I can tune to, "RTL" is to vague for that, so satellite and frequency would be good start) And does the recording have to be long, or is 10 minutes or so enough to reproduce it?
Real musicians never die - they just decompose

Re: CT ET9x00 and newest PLI -> spool records problems ! #44 MiLo

  • PLi® Core member
  • 14,055 posts

+298
Excellent

Posted 30 November 2011 - 20:12

And is it the .ap file which is faulty (how do you know?), or just "either the .sc or .ap" (because running the reconstruction fixes it, and that reconstructs both .ap and .sc files).

Another thing, if you could save the original corrupted .ap file and the reconstructed, correct one, and post or send it, that might help already. Those are pretty small files.
Real musicians never die - they just decompose

Re: CT ET9x00 and newest PLI -> spool records problems ! #45 Pike_Bishop

  • Senior Member
  • 1,140 posts

+74
Good

Posted 30 November 2011 - 20:35

Hi MiLo,

Another thing, if you could save the original corrupted .ap file and the reconstructed, correct one, and post or send it, that might help already. Those are pretty small files.

yes i will do this today or tomorrow.

we have the spooling prob with freeze higher than 16x at the followig channels;

Rtl
Rtl2
Super Rtl
Vox
NDR
phoenix

and maybe nor by other channels too.

it is enough to reproduce this problem with a recording with 10 minutes lenght.
it looks as it's only the .ts.ap file corrupt.
when we remove this .ts.ap file then the same recording with spooling higher than 16x is ok.
when we remove all meta files and let EMC make the new files to spool then EMC make only the ts.meta and the .ts.sc file
so that spooling is also correct because the .ts.ap file was not created again,
but in this two examples we have artefacts at spooling.

when we make for the problem records the spooling files new with the plugin reconstructapsc so this plugin creates the .ts.meta the .ts.sc
and also the .ts.ap file new, and then we can spooling without problems and without artefacts.

regards
Biki3

Edited by Biki3, 30 November 2011 - 20:38.

Receiver: VU Ultimo 4K, Octagon SF8008 4K, Gigablue Quad 4K

Image: OpenPLI-8.3


Re: CT ET9x00 and newest PLI -> spool records problems ! #46 PainHealer

  • Member
  • 17 posts

0
Neutral

Posted 30 November 2011 - 20:43

Hello MiLo,

one user at CT Forums found that deleting the .ap alone does the trick. After deleting this file, the recording that formerly could not be spooled above 8x will immediatly be "spoolable" at all speeds. Also, using "reconstruc" will always help.

Attached you will find a set of .ap/.sc-files, before and after reconstruct. before it "hangs" at 12x/16x when inital wind speed was 4x.

Channels on Astra 19.2E where the problem usually occurs:

RTL Germany SD Astra 1L H 1.089 27500 3/4 12188
Vox Germany SD Astra 1L H 1.089 27500 3/4 12188

and there are other channels also. If needed, I will write down more.

Regards

PainHealer

Attached Files


Edited by PainHealer, 30 November 2011 - 20:45.


Re: CT ET9x00 and newest PLI -> spool records problems ! #47 Pike_Bishop

  • Senior Member
  • 1,140 posts

+74
Good

Posted 30 November 2011 - 21:01

Hi MiLo,

Another thing, if you could save the original corrupted .ap file and the reconstructed, correct one, and post or send it, that might help already. Those are pretty small files.

ok here i post now the corrupt and the repaired .ts.ap file in the attachement.
these are the files for the spooling problem with freeze by spooling higher than 16x.

Thanks for your interest.

regards
Biki3

Edited by Biki3, 30 November 2011 - 21:04.

Receiver: VU Ultimo 4K, Octagon SF8008 4K, Gigablue Quad 4K

Image: OpenPLI-8.3


Re: CT ET9x00 and newest PLI -> spool records problems ! #48 Pike_Bishop

  • Senior Member
  • 1,140 posts

+74
Good

Posted 30 November 2011 - 21:35

Sorry i forgott the zip file.

regards
Biki3

Attached Files


Receiver: VU Ultimo 4K, Octagon SF8008 4K, Gigablue Quad 4K

Image: OpenPLI-8.3


Re: CT ET9x00 and newest PLI -> spool records problems ! #49 MiLo

  • PLi® Core member
  • 14,055 posts

+298
Excellent

Posted 3 December 2011 - 10:14

The .ap files are identical in both cases.

PainHealer's .sc files are different though.
Real musicians never die - they just decompose

Re: CT ET9x00 and newest PLI -> spool records problems ! #50 MiLo

  • PLi® Core member
  • 14,055 posts

+298
Excellent

Posted 3 December 2011 - 11:13

A 10-minute recording from VOX indeed has the problem. It's the "ts.sc" file that appears to be incorrect, the .ap file is okay.
Real musicians never die - they just decompose

Re: CT ET9x00 and newest PLI -> spool records problems ! #51 Pike_Bishop

  • Senior Member
  • 1,140 posts

+74
Good

Posted 3 December 2011 - 13:05

Hi MiLo,

thanks for reply.

The .ap files are identical in both cases.

i think you mean the files of my attached .zip, but i don't understand it because i have maked
the repaired .ts.ap file with reconstructapsc and with this spooling higher than 16x is full ok.
with the original .ts.ap file however spooling higher than 16x is not correct, here it comes to the freeze.
i don't understand why this is so.


A 10-minute recording from VOX indeed has the problem.

can you make to this record new meta files with reconstructapsc, then you have a new .ts.ap file and spooling is allright,
so you can compare then itself the original.ts.ap file with the .ts.ap file by reconstructapsc.


It's the "ts.sc" file that appears to be incorrect, the .ap file is okay

hmm, i'am confused :blink: -> i thought as yet that the .ts.ap file is the problem.

regards
Biki3

Receiver: VU Ultimo 4K, Octagon SF8008 4K, Gigablue Quad 4K

Image: OpenPLI-8.3


Re: CT ET9x00 and newest PLI -> spool records problems ! #52 MiLo

  • PLi® Core member
  • 14,055 posts

+298
Excellent

Posted 3 December 2011 - 14:12

Removing either "ap" or "sc" file will stop enigma2 using both. I'm confused as to what the files actually do, it appears both are needed, if you remove one, the other one won't be used either. That explains why removing the .ap file fixes the problem - it runs okay because it doesn't use the .sc file then. Which makes me wonder what use they are anyway, it runs just fine without them...
Real musicians never die - they just decompose

Re: CT ET9x00 and newest PLI -> spool records problems ! #53 Pike_Bishop

  • Senior Member
  • 1,140 posts

+74
Good

Posted 3 December 2011 - 15:55

Hi MiLo,

you are right, when only removing the .ts.ap file then spooling works higher then 16x
but in this records i can see artefacts specific by spooling rewind.
in records for they i make new meta files with reconstructapsc i can't see artefacts by spooling and this records i can also spooling higher than 16x correct.

but it's really a confused problem this spooling problem and it is also more confusing that it is not on records from all channels.
have we a chance for a fix to this problem in the future ?

thanks for your interest to this thread and for your reply.

regards
Biki3

Edited by Biki3, 3 December 2011 - 15:57.

Receiver: VU Ultimo 4K, Octagon SF8008 4K, Gigablue Quad 4K

Image: OpenPLI-8.3


Re: CT ET9x00 and newest PLI -> spool records problems ! #54 MiLo

  • PLi® Core member
  • 14,055 posts

+298
Excellent

Posted 10 December 2011 - 17:24

This commit appears to improve things. At least, the .sc files that enigma2 creates now match the ones from the plugin on VOX recordings.
http://openpli.git.s...366714205fb667f
Had to write a Python program just to analyze the files...

For the techies: The difference in the "bad" and "good" sc files is that the "bad" ones just lack about 1% of the data records. I can't explain how that would cause that winding behaviour. After the change, the .sc file that enigma generates matches the one from the plugin, except for the last few data records. I guess that happens on all recordings.
Real musicians never die - they just decompose

Re: CT ET9x00 and newest PLI -> spool records problems ! #55 PainHealer

  • Member
  • 17 posts

0
Neutral

Posted 11 December 2011 - 15:52

Hello MiLo,

thanks for working on a fix for this issue! It seems that the basic problem with the recordings is now fixed. I did three recordings from the "problematic" channels (RTL Germany, VOX, RTL II) today and everything looks good when winding during playback, even above 12x/16x.

However, the other problems mentioned - winding hangs/slideshow when inital winding speed above 12x and heavy artefacts while winding back during playback of a channel/event that is still activly recording, which is basically the same "effect" as when winding back in timeshift mode - are still there. I think we have already discovered, that this happens out of other technical reasons.

Do you think there is a chance to improve/fix the other winding issues also?

Best regards

PainHealer

Re: CT ET9x00 and newest PLI -> spool records problems ! #56 Pike_Bishop

  • Senior Member
  • 1,140 posts

+74
Good

Posted 11 December 2011 - 20:14

Hi MiLo,

This commit appears to improve things. At least, the .sc files that enigma2 creates now match the ones from the plugin on VOX recordings.
http://openpli.git.s...366714205fb667f
Had to write a Python program just to analyze the files...

Thanks for your great work.

regards
Biki3

Edited by Biki3, 11 December 2011 - 20:15.

Receiver: VU Ultimo 4K, Octagon SF8008 4K, Gigablue Quad 4K

Image: OpenPLI-8.3


Re: CT ET9x00 and newest PLI -> spool records problems ! #57 MiLo

  • PLi® Core member
  • 14,055 posts

+298
Excellent

Posted 16 December 2011 - 10:06

... heavy artefacts while winding back during playback of a channel/event that is still activly recording, which is basically the same "effect"


This one should be solved now (committed a few days ago). If you play a recording that's still running, you can now smoothly rewind and wind it. Even if you play it on another box than the one that's recording. As a bonus, writing the .sc files now uses considerably less CPU and memory, and parsing them should also be a lot more efficient (though I doubt you'll be able to notice it in real life). Also missing ".ap" files no longer have any effect on spooling (deleting the .ap file seems to have no ill effect at all, I noticed...)
This only works for recordings, the timeshift is still just as horrible as it was. And the "enter at 12x" is also still unsolved.
Real musicians never die - they just decompose


3 user(s) are reading this topic

0 members, 3 guests, 0 anonymous users